"Wolf of Wall Street" - new DiCaprio movie

Trailer just released for this new flick based on Jordan Belfort's life as a stockbroker in the '80s and '90s.

Movie looks interesting and hopefully is better than the LeBeouf Wall Street drivel that was put out recently. November 15th release date.
